.features-page[data-astro-cid-fsswmxcn]{padding-top:80px}.features-hero[data-astro-cid-fsswmxcn]{padding:6rem 0 4rem;text-align:center}.features-hero[data-astro-cid-fsswmxcn] h1[data-astro-cid-fsswmxcn]{font-size:clamp(2.5rem,5vw,3.5rem);margin:1rem 0}.hero-subtitle[data-astro-cid-fsswmxcn]{color:var(--color-text-secondary);font-size:1.25rem;max-width:600px;margin:0 auto}.feature-section[data-astro-cid-fsswmxcn]{padding:5rem 0}.feature-section-alt[data-astro-cid-fsswmxcn]{background:var(--color-bg-elevated)}.feature-grid[data-astro-cid-fsswmxcn]{display:grid;grid-template-columns:1fr 1fr;gap:4rem;align-items:center}.feature-grid-reverse[data-astro-cid-fsswmxcn] .feature-content[data-astro-cid-fsswmxcn]{order:2}.feature-badge[data-astro-cid-fsswmxcn]{background:#8b5cf61a;color:var(--color-primary);padding:.25rem .75rem;border-radius:2rem;font-size:.75rem;font-weight:600;text-transform:uppercase}.feature-content[data-astro-cid-fsswmxcn] h2[data-astro-cid-fsswmxcn]{font-size:2rem;margin:1rem 0}.feature-lead[data-astro-cid-fsswmxcn]{font-size:1.125rem;color:var(--color-text-secondary);line-height:1.8;margin-bottom:2rem}.feature-list[data-astro-cid-fsswmxcn]{list-style:none}.feature-list[data-astro-cid-fsswmxcn] li[data-astro-cid-fsswmxcn]{display:flex;gap:1rem;padding:1rem 0;border-bottom:1px solid var(--color-border)}.feature-list[data-astro-cid-fsswmxcn] li[data-astro-cid-fsswmxcn]:last-child{border-bottom:none}.feature-list[data-astro-cid-fsswmxcn] .icon[data-astro-cid-fsswmxcn]{width:32px;height:32px;background:var(--color-primary);color:#fff;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:.75rem;font-weight:700;flex-shrink:0}.feature-list[data-astro-cid-fsswmxcn] strong[data-astro-cid-fsswmxcn]{display:block;margin-bottom:.25rem}.feature-list[data-astro-cid-fsswmxcn] p[data-astro-cid-fsswmxcn]{color:var(--color-text-secondary);font-size:.875rem;margin:0}.feature-visual[data-astro-cid-fsswmxcn] img[data-astro-cid-fsswmxcn]{width:100%;max-width:500px;border-radius:var(--radius-xl)}.visual-placeholder[data-astro-cid-fsswmxcn]{width:100%;max-width:400px;aspect-ratio:1;background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-xl);display:flex;align-items:center;justify-content:center}.placeholder-icon[data-astro-cid-fsswmxcn]{font-size:4rem;color:var(--color-primary);opacity:.3}.comparison-table-section[data-astro-cid-fsswmxcn]{padding:5rem 0}.comparison-table-wrapper[data-astro-cid-fsswmxcn]{overflow-x:auto}.comparison-table[data-astro-cid-fsswmxcn]{width:100%;border-collapse:collapse;margin-top:2rem}.comparison-table[data-astro-cid-fsswmxcn] th[data-astro-cid-fsswmxcn],.comparison-table[data-astro-cid-fsswmxcn] td[data-astro-cid-fsswmxcn]{padding:1rem;text-align:center;border-bottom:1px solid var(--color-border)}.comparison-table[data-astro-cid-fsswmxcn] th[data-astro-cid-fsswmxcn]{font-weight:600;background:var(--color-bg-elevated)}.comparison-table[data-astro-cid-fsswmxcn] th[data-astro-cid-fsswmxcn].highlight{background:#8b5cf61a;color:var(--color-primary)}.comparison-table[data-astro-cid-fsswmxcn] td[data-astro-cid-fsswmxcn]:first-child{text-align:left;font-weight:500}.comparison-table[data-astro-cid-fsswmxcn] .yes[data-astro-cid-fsswmxcn]{color:var(--color-success);font-weight:700}.comparison-table[data-astro-cid-fsswmxcn] .no[data-astro-cid-fsswmxcn]{color:#ef4444}.comparison-table[data-astro-cid-fsswmxcn] .maybe[data-astro-cid-fsswmxcn]{color:#f59e0b}.features-cta[data-astro-cid-fsswmxcn]{padding:5rem 0;background:var(--color-bg-elevated)}.features-cta[data-astro-cid-fsswmxcn] .cta-card[data-astro-cid-fsswmxcn]{background:linear-gradient(135deg,#8b5cf61a,#06b6d41a);border:1px solid var(--color-border);border-radius:var(--radius-2xl);padding:4rem;text-align:center}.features-cta[data-astro-cid-fsswmxcn] h2[data-astro-cid-fsswmxcn]{font-size:2rem;margin-bottom:.5rem}.features-cta[data-astro-cid-fsswmxcn] p[data-astro-cid-fsswmxcn]{color:var(--color-text-secondary);margin-bottom:2rem}@media(max-width:1024px){.feature-grid[data-astro-cid-fsswmxcn]{grid-template-columns:1fr}.feature-grid-reverse[data-astro-cid-fsswmxcn] .feature-content[data-astro-cid-fsswmxcn]{order:0}.feature-visual[data-astro-cid-fsswmxcn]{order:-1}}
